Based on your requirements There are a range of different treadmills available in the UK market. You should first consider how much space is available in your home. The bigger the treadmill is, the more expensive it will be.

If you have a limited space, you could opt for a folding treadmill. They fold up when not in use, which helps to save space. These treadmills come with assisted-dropping technology, which allows you to easily raise or lower the deck.

Reebok's Jet 300 is a good entry-level treadmill. It comes with an LCD display that is basic and a tablet stand, however it is powerful enough to give you an excellent running experience. The treadmill can reach the maximum speed of 20 kph and is comfortable on your joints because it has an air motion cushioned deck. It also has a handy USB port for your smartphone, so you can stream a film or listen to a podcast while working out.

Incline

If you're seeking a treadmill that can give you the complete running experience, consider one with a higher-than-average incline. It is recommended to choose an exercise machine with a slope of between three percent and fifteen percent to simulate both uphill and Treadmills For Home UK downhill runs. This is especially helpful for those who want to change their workout routine and push themselves.

The slope of a treadmill increases the difficulty of a run, without increasing speed. This is an excellent method to burn more calories without risking injury. However, walking on an incline can exacerbate lower back pain in certain people If you suffer from this problem, then it is recommended to avoid all incline-based workouts.

Many treadmills have built-in workout programs that automatically regulate your speed and incline for you. The menus can differ in size and variety however, they all should let you choose between a range of different exercises that will help you achieve your fitness goals.

One of the most important aspects to consider is the size of the treadmill for sale and the amount of space it will occupy when in use. The cheapest models for consumers typically only take up 120cm in size and 60cm in width when in use, however you'll need a lot more space for larger and commercial-grade treadmills.

Another aspect to consider is the maximum speed the treadmill can reach. The speed will depend on whether you plan to walk, jog lightly, or run seriously. You want a machine capable of handling your desired level.
